In this paper, the following conclusions:1. The dynamic changes of land use of Wanzhou District. This paper analyzed the Wanzhou District land-use type of structure, quantity, rate of change and speed. For nine years.arable land, corner and other agricultural land, unused land in Wanzhou District has shown a decreasing trend; forest land, construction sites continue to increase. In Land-use changes the increases of forest area is the largest, totalling an increase of 21721.84 hectares; reduce the largest area of arable land and unused land, a decrease of 14398.7 hectares of arable land, unused land decreased by 13,261 hectares.2. Using PSR model, combined the social, economic, environmental and other realities in Wanzhou District of Chongqing, through qualitative and quantitative analysis of the method of combining, from the land pressure, status, protection and rectification on the ecological environment, and other aspects of the 18 factors, chosen as the evaluation factors, the establishment of the reservoir area of land resources Wanzhou ecological security evaluation index system. It is formed a complete system of indicators including, weight, evaluation criteria and evaluation of land resources, model ecological security evaluation methods. using PSR model for land resources ecological security evaluation index system, using AHP for index system of weights, using unsafe index for non-dimensional, to the ecological security situation in a time series analysis from 1998-2005. The results showed that the Wanzhou District of land resources ecological security of insecurity fell to 0.3664from 0.3896, is the overall direction of a virtuous circle of development, but progress has been slow. Through analysis of the indicators that the Wanzhou District of Chongqing Land Resources tremendous pressure to the ecological environment, Primarily reflected in population pressure, land pressure, economic pressure and industrial consumption. The quality of the land resources of ecological environment has been improved, ecological and environmental protection of land resources for capacity-building training has a greater increase.3. Using the ecological footprint for Wanzhou District of Chongqing, Chongqing, as well as with the hinterland of the reservoir area of Fengdu County, Analysised space compared on the ecological security of land resources.It is conclusion: Wanzhou District per capita ecological deficit 1.336809 hm~2, Fengdu County's per capita ecological deficit of 1.671064 hm~2, Chongqing City's per capita ecological deficit of 1.247310 hm~2. Wanzhou District's per capita ecological deficit is between Chongqing and Fengdu County, and it's at the lower level. However, Wanzhou District's eco-pressure index is 9.52, far higher than the 2.79 of Chongqing, also higher than the 6.28 of Fengdu County, ecological security situation of Wanzhou District is extremely grim. Wanzhou District and Fengdu County in the reservoir area, the ecological deficit is significantly higher than the level of Chongqing, that the reservoir area of ecological security situation is still grim.
